What is Variable Cost Forecasting?

Table of Content
  1. No sections available

Definition

Variable Cost Forecasting is the process of estimating future costs that change in direct relation to business activity, production volume, sales levels, or service delivery. Unlike fixed costs, Variable Cost fluctuates based on operational demand and includes expenses such as raw materials, sales commissions, shipping costs, transaction fees, and production labor.

Organizations use Variable Cost Forecasting to improve budgeting accuracy, optimize resource allocation, and align spending projections with expected business performance. It is a critical component of financial planning because variable expenses often represent a significant portion of total operating costs.

How Variable Cost Forecasting Works

The forecasting process begins by identifying costs that vary with business activity and determining the relationship between cost levels and operational drivers. Common drivers include units produced, customer orders, service transactions, or sales revenue.

Finance teams analyze historical trends and operational assumptions to estimate future activity levels. Forecasted volumes are then multiplied by expected variable cost rates to project future spending requirements.

This approach helps organizations anticipate how cost structures will respond to growth, seasonal fluctuations, or changing market conditions.

Calculation Method and Example

A common forecasting formula is:

Projected Variable Cost = Forecast Activity Volume × Variable Cost Per Unit

For example, a manufacturer expects to produce 50,000 units next quarter and estimates direct material costs of $12 per unit.

Projected Variable Cost = 50,000 × $12 = $600,000

If production volume increases to 60,000 units, projected material costs automatically increase to $720,000. This direct relationship makes variable cost forecasting highly responsive to operational changes.

Finance teams frequently monitor the Variable Cost Ratio to evaluate how variable costs change relative to revenue or production activity.

Relationship to Financial Performance

Accurate variable cost forecasts improve visibility into future profitability because variable costs directly influence gross margins and operating income. Understanding cost behavior enables management to evaluate the financial impact of volume growth, pricing changes, and efficiency initiatives.
